Let it charge a couple of hours, and then check the voltage again.
Probably after 4 hours of charging, then the voltage should be high enough to be over 13.2 volts.
If your voltage is below 12.8 volts, check for a blown fuse between the converter and the battery. It might be the pair of fuses right on the converter/charger. Check the voltage at the converter output. If you are getting 13.2 volts there, and only 12.6 at the battery, then the circuit breaker or fuse between the converter or battery fuse box and the battery wire might be tripped, or a fuse blown.
